During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Mercer paid an average of $956 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$28,695 | $28,695 |
Fees | $300 | $300 |
Books and Supplies | $1,200 | $1,200 |
On Campus Room and Board | $13,070 | $13,070 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$2,778 | $2,778 |

One factor in determining the overall cost in a degree is to consider how much in student loans you’ll have to take out. Students who received their bachelor’s degree at Mercer in General Business walked away with an average of $43,875 in student debt. That is 63% higher than the national average of $26,843.
general business who receive their bachelor’s degree from Mercer make an average of $47,595 a year during the early days of their career. That is 15% higher than the national average of $41,384.

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in general business in 2019-2020, 69.0%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 47.5%.
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 62.1% of the general business bachelor’s degrees at Mercer in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 34%.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 18 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|
White | 7 |
International Students | 1 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 3 |
